Eric Wolfgang Fotherby has been telling his unique life stories on comfy living room couches and well-worn bar-room stools for decades. Recently he’s turned to poetry to rewire these stories in a new rhythmic literary form.

With his vast vocabulary and jocular wit, Fotherby shares draft dodging stories from the Vietnam War years, his epic travel adventures, passionate bromantic poems about the Seattle Mariners and Seattle Seahawks, and his current reflections on a life well lived.

Included are his true-life tales of examining a frozen Sasquatch in a shopping mall parking lot, being abducted by a crooked cop in the deserts of Mexico, fending off poisonous snakes and spiders in the wilds of Florida, cleverly exacting revenge on a shady insurance agent, and his most famous story – sustaining a serious shark bite in the waters off Hawaii.
